Understanding Percolator Bongs With Splash Guard

When using percolator bongs with a splash guard, you'll notice a smoother and cleaner smoking experience due to the enhanced filtration system. Bong filtration is important for a refined smoking session, and the addition of a splash guard helps prevent any water from reaching your mouth while inhaling. The percolator bong's design includes multiple filtration chambers that work to cool down the smoke and filter out impurities, providing you with a pure and flavorful hit.

The smoke diffusion in percolator bongs with a splash guard is optimized for maximum smoothness. As you take a hit, the smoke is first filtered through the water chamber, then directed through various percolators that further break down the smoke into smaller bubbles. These bubbles increase the surface area of the smoke, allowing it to cool down efficiently and remove any harshness before inhalation.

Filling the Water Chamber Correctly

For peak functionality, make sure the water chamber of your percolator bong is filled correctly to enhance your smoking experience. Proper maintenance of the water level is essential for the best filtration and smooth hits. To fill the water chamber correctly, start by pouring water through the mouthpiece until it reaches just above the percolator slits. Be mindful not to overfill, as this can lead to water reaching your mouth while inhaling.

Maintaining the right water level ensures that the percolator functions effectively, providing the desired filtration for a cleaner smoke. The water acts as a filtration system, cooling down the smoke and removing impurities, resulting in a more enjoyable smoking experience. Regularly changing the water and cleaning the bong will help maintain excellent filtration and prevent any buildup of residue that can affect the taste and quality of your hits.

Adding Ice for Cooler Hits

To enhance the cooling effect of your hits, consider adding ice to your percolator bong for a smoother and more invigorating smoking experience. Placing ice in your bong offers several benefits for an improved session:

  • Ice placement: Drop a few ice cubes or crushed ice into the neck of your bong to cool the smoke before it reaches your lungs.
  • Benefits: The ice cools the smoke, making it less harsh on your throat and lungs, resulting in a smoother hit.
  • Temperature regulation: Adding ice helps regulate the temperature of the smoke, allowing you to take bigger, smoother hits without the discomfort of hot smoke.
  • Effects: The cooling effect of the ice can enhance the overall experience, making each inhale more invigorating and enjoyable.

Cleaning and Maintaining Your Bong

To keep your percolator bong performing at its best, regular cleaning and maintenance are important. Here are some tips to make sure your bong stays in top condition:

  • Deep Cleaning: It's vital to give your bong a thorough cleaning periodically to remove any buildup of resin, bacteria, or mold. Use cleaning solutions specifically designed for bongs and follow the instructions carefully.
  • Maintenance Schedule: Establish a regular maintenance schedule to prevent residue from accumulating and affecting the flavor of your smoke. Consider cleaning your bong after every few uses or at least once a week if you're a frequent user.
  • Rinse After Each Use: Get into the habit of rinsing your bong with warm water after each use to prevent residue from hardening and becoming more challenging to remove.
  • Inspect Regularly: Take the time to inspect your bong for any cracks, chips, or loose parts.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ent further damage and maintain the functionality of your bong.

Cleaning Techniques

For a spotless experience with your percolator bong sporting a splash guard, tackle common issues through effective cleaning techniques.

To keep your bong in top shape, deep cleaning is key. Start by disassembling the bong, removing any removable parts such as the splash guard, downstem, and bowl. Soak these components in a solution of isopropyl alcohol and warm water to break down stubborn residues. Utilize pipe cleaners, brushes, and cotton swabs to reach all nooks and crannies. Rinse thoroughly with warm water and allow everything to dry completely before reassembling.

For regular maintenance, frequent residue removal is essential. Use specialized bong cleaning solutions or a mixture of vinegar and baking soda for a quick clean between deep cleans.
